Can anyone advice me how far bisangas clinic is from brussels int air port? Also how's it best to get there? Is there busses regularly? Or is taxi best? If so any idea of costs? Never been to Brussels and am useless at travel as I am at typing,spelling on this forum! All info appreciated! Euro star not really an option as it would take 3 hrs to get to london before actually travelling to brussels!

its about 30 mins from the airport , you go down escalator at airport , jump train for 3 stops , then either walk (15 mins) or get taxi , you can also get a tram , i walked and found it pretty easy

 

hope this helps
